Ophir-Spiricon given outstanding technology business award

Ophir-Spiricon has been presented with an outstanding technology business of the year award by Cache Chamber of Commerce, at the Chamber's 2012 annual awards banquet at Utah State University.

Ophir-Spiricon was given the award because the Chamber of Commerce decided the company exemplified the type of business the chamber wanted to see locate in Cache Valley Utah, and stay and grow. The award was presented to Gary Wagner, president of Ophir-Spiricon, at the Chamber's 2012 annual awards banquet at Utah State University.

Sandra Emile, CEO of the Cache Chamber of Commerce said: ‘They represent clean, innovative industry, steady growth and above average paying jobs with excellent employee benefits. We applaud their success in the laser technology industry.’

Ophir-Spiricon develops technology for the use of lasers in eye surgery, industrial welding and military guidance systems. Spiricon was founded in 1978 by Dr Carlos Roundy, who received his degree in Physics from Utah State University. Spiricon is now Ophir-Spiricon, a multi-national company.
